Re: Retirement of the Stonebriar product line

Stonebriar sales have declined for five consecutive quarters and support costs now exceed contribution margin. The retirement plan is staged: new orders close end of Q2, existing contracts honoured through their terms, and spares stocked for twenty-four months. Sales leads should steer prospects toward the Ashgrove range; migration incentives are already approved. Customer comms are drafted and awaiting legal sign-off. The forward strategy behind this decision is set out in the note below.

confidential, yafog-hagug: Gross margin on Druix came in at 10 percent against a plan of 15 percent. Only 5 of the 80 pilot accounts renewed Druix, so a churn review is set for October 1.

Q: Where are the search relevance tuning notes, and who can change weights?

A: Relevance weights for Findable's query ranker live in a signed config bundle, not in code. Only the Ranking Guild can merge changes, and every weight edit is logged with reviewer identity and a before/after diff. Synonym lists and boost rules are reviewed quarterly. No user data leaves the tuning sandbox; offline judgments come from the Quillmark panel. The full audit trail and current weight table are published on the internal notes page below.

wiki page, kageg-fawip: https://jira.tolvaqsys.internal/projects/pages/pages/a21b2f71

# Heads up, new folks: this block wires up the Tumblevault client,
# which talks to the laundry-locker access service. The flow is:
# resident scans their fob, we ask Tumblevault for a one-time door
# grant, then poll until the locker confirms the latch opened.
# Timeouts are aggressive (3s) because people stand there waiting.
# The client authenticates with the staging key below.

gateway credential: kto15_BFZGGy3oznOSd45